Understanding Bali’s Visa-Free Entry for Romantic Travellers
Bali, part of Indonesia, operates under national immigration policies, which include visa-free entry for many countries. This allows travellers to enter without the need to apply for a visa beforehand. For couples planning a romantic escape, this policy simplifies travel logistics, letting you focus on enjoying your getaway. Upon arrival at Ngurah Rai International Airport, the main gateway to Bali, eligible travellers are granted a visa exemption. It’s important to note that while the visa-free entry is convenient, it typically allows for a stay of up to 30 days. Couples should ensure their passports are valid for at least six months beyond the date of entry. For those seeking longer stays or special arrangements, exploring visa-on-arrival options might be necessary. Always confirm the most current entry requirements with official Indonesian immigration sources before your trip.
Luxury Accommodation Options for Couples in Bali
Bali’s accommodation market is tailored for romance, offering a range of private villas and resorts ideal for couples. In areas like Seminyak, Ubud, and Uluwatu, you can find premium private-pool villas priced between USD 250–700 per night. These villas often feature romantic amenities like floating breakfasts, enhancing the intimate experience. For those looking for beachfront luxury, expect higher rates, particularly with branded options. Properties such as Le Cielo Romantic Villas specifically cater to couples, ensuring privacy and exclusivity. Additionally, honeymoon packages are popular, bundling accommodation with transfers and activities, providing a hassle-free romantic itinerary. For instance, The Seven Holiday offers packages that include stays at 4-star properties like Candi Beach Resort & Spa, providing luxury ocean-view suites perfect for couples. Safety and Authenticity: Avoiding Scams
As with any popular tourist destination, Bali has its share of scams, particularly involving accommodation bookings. Reports of fraudulent villa listings using stolen photos are not uncommon. To avoid scams, ensure you are booking through verified channels. Check for official social media accounts or use recognized booking platforms. Be cautious of newly registered domains or missing contact information, which are common red flags. Local operators advise couples to verify the authenticity of their bookings to ensure a smooth experience. It’s crucial to remain vigilant and informed to protect your investment in a romantic escape.
Navigating Legalities for Weddings and Vow Renewals
For couples considering a legal marriage in Bali, understanding the legal requirements is essential. Indonesian law requires compliance with both local and home country regulations, often involving documentation like affidavits of no impediment. However, symbolic ceremonies and vow renewals are widely available and do not require the same level of documentation. Resorts and planners offer these services, allowing couples to celebrate their love without the bureaucratic complexities. If planning a legal ceremony, ensure you have all necessary paperwork prepared in advance. For symbolic ceremonies, focus on personalizing the experience to reflect your unique relationship.
Current Climate and Best Time to Visit
Bali enjoys a tropical climate year-round, with a dry season from April to October and a wetter monsoon period from November to March. The weather can significantly impact outdoor activities, so timing your visit is crucial for a seamless experience. The dry season is ideal for beach days and exploring Bali’s natural beauty. However, the monsoon season offers a quieter atmosphere with fewer tourists, which some couples might prefer.
